Output b50515d924b77626530aa1f18de3f71d3bc431391a09d15278e6b1c01334472e:0

value
2706097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f4ac32ca5cbdcfb019d822fc751a676c50cf73 OP_EQUAL
address
3MCJxZHJk3evia9BFxzzub8Qysse6hcFTL
transaction
b50515d924b77626530aa1f18de3f71d3bc431391a09d15278e6b1c01334472e
spent
true